# Tracking the leaked-file-descriptor hunt in Harrowmill's worker pool.
# We lowered pool_max to 12 and enabled fd auditing; descriptors were
# leaking in the retry path of the export job. Reviewer: keep these
# values until the fix in branch fd-hunt lands. Audit logs land in the
# metrics database, reached via the connection string below.

replica DSN, yahaf-yagaf: mongodb://tamath_svc:a2netSk3RZMuTj@db-d084.novacsoft.internal:5432/ralmir

Welcome aboard — here's the quick version before Thursday's leadership review. We've agreed in principle to sell the Coastal Logistics unit to Brennan & Vale Holdings. The unit's been profitable but off-strategy since we pivoted to the Quillware platform, and Marta Osei's team has run the diligence cleanly. Expect questions from the board about retention packages for the Harborview staff and the transition services agreement. Most of it is settled; the sticking points are pricing earn-outs and timing. The key detail you'll need is below.

management briefing: Project Ulavan slips by two quarters because of the staffing delay.

### Account Recovery — Catalogue Import (Lintwood)

Quick one for review: when the Lintwood catalogue import wipes a patron's session table, the recovery flow re-seeds accounts from the nightly snapshot. Check that the importer skips locked accounts — last time it didn't. To rerun recovery against staging you'll need the vault passphrase, which is appended just below.

recovery phrase for yafof-tajof: julmir-kelax-julvan-holath-belvan-holir-ralael-ralvan-ralath-julvan-silmir-istmir-kaswyn-ulamir